因此,我为 2007 年的 MacBook(型号标识符 MacBook2,1)定制了 Lubuntu 18.04 安装,以便获得最佳性能。对于这些设备来说,这是性能和资源较少的操作系统之间的最佳折衷。由于该设备的风扇坏了,并且由于过热而关闭,我订购了一个新风扇,并决定在另一台设备(稍新的 2009 年的 MacBook(型号标识符 MacBook4,1))上完成所有 Lubuntu 设置,然后将硬盘放在较旧的设备上。
因此我创建了一个可启动的 USB 安装程序,2009 款 MacBook 可以立即识别它,并且我能够安装它。
我设置好了一切所需,然后将硬盘放入 2007 年的 MacBook,但... 它没有出现在启动菜单中。
当然,我认为我的安装有问题,或者只是硬盘交换不起作用,所以我将 USB 安装程序插入其中... 也没有显示!
两台 MacBook 均运行正常,旧款甚至可以从另一台设备启动到 Windows HDD。
我陷入了困境,我不想从 OS X 进行双启动。而且,现在我知道我的安装不是问题,我有点想让它从那个 HDD 启动,因为我对它做了相当多的设置。
我该如何解决这个问题?
答案1
型号标识符为MacBook2,1和MacBook4,1具有 64 位处理器。但是,并非所有型号标识符为MacBook2,1具有 64 位 EFI,而所有型号标识符为MacBook4,1有 64 位 EFI。因此,如果你使用型号标识符为 MacBook4,1 的 Mac 安装 Lubuntu 以进行 EFI 启动,则尝试使用型号标识符为MacBook2,132 位 EFI 将会导致失败。
如果您的 Mac 具有 32 位 EFI,而您希望安装 64 位 Linux,则需要安装 Linux 以进行 BIOS 启动。您仍应能够安装 Linux 以使用 GPT 分区。但是,Mac 需要混合分区才能启用 BIOS 启动。使用 DVD 安装可能更容易,但使用闪存驱动器也是可能的。这将需要一个可以进行 EFI 启动的 Linux 安装程序,但要安装 BIOS 启动 GRUB。过去,Debian 安装程序能够做到这一点,现在可能仍然能够做到这一点。一旦您有了 BIOS 启动 GRUB,您就可以使用它来 BIOS 启动其他 Linux 安装程序,然后替换 Debian。您可以想象,整个过程可能会变得复杂。如果您想进一步了解,可以发表评论。
你可能考虑尝试安装 64 位启动 BIOSXubuntu 20.04 LTS,即使这需要升级到 2 GB(价格为 12 美元)。
我添加了下面的链接,这样以后就不必再去寻找它们了。
参考
在没有 Mac OS X 的情况下在 MacBook Pro 15 英寸“Core 2 Duo”上安装 Windows
新安装的 Debian 在 MacBook Pro“Core 2 Duo”2.16 上卡在加载状态
从可启动 USB 和可启动 DVD 安装 Ubuntu 的替代方法
在第一代 Mac Pro 1,1 上启动 64 位 Ubuntu 映像
无需 DVD 或闪存驱动器安装 Ubuntu